Tony Lee Moral crafts tales of mystery and suspense, drawing inspiration from the storytelling techniques of Alfred Hitchcock. He masterfully employs plot, character, setting, and key details to weave engaging narratives filled with intrigue, tension, and retribution. His own thrillers, such as the recently released The Haunting of Alice May, explore themes of mystery, crime, and the paranormal. Moral's work focuses on building compelling narratives that draw readers into the darker aspects of the human psyche and the supernatural.
